Mikel Arteta gave an animated response when quizzed on a marketing campaign to guard referees from abuse.
A marketing campaign within the Every day Mail has been launched to try to defend matchday officers from undue abuse, itemizing the Arsenal boss amongst plenty of culprits who’ve fueled the criticism that they face.
The Gunners have been on the centre of plenty of refereeing controversies, most notably the VAR name that dominated in favour of Newcastle as Anthony Gordon secured a 1-0 win for the Magpies at St Jam.
This led Arteta to be charged by the FA after branding the VAR choice ‘a shame’.
When requested in regards to the marketing campaign, Arteta delivered an impassioned response, saying that emotion is what makes Premier League soccer so particular.
Talking in his press convention, Arteta stated: “I noticed the article, noticed the marketing campaign and noticed my image however I took it as a praise as a result of I’ve been right here 20 years and I’ve supported the league, the gamers, the referees and I’ve promoted the sport, all the time, in the very best method.
“I count on that if we wish to proceed to try this then it’s a must to give your opinion and I’ve given a whole bunch of opinions, however if you wish to isolate one in a single second to speak about one thing I consider and use it another way? I don’t assume that’s honest.
“We dwell the sport, you recognize, with emotion. I react when a participant scores a aim, yeah? I react when a participant provides the ball away, yeah? I react to an official when he desires to fly on the pitch and provides remedy and I say ‘no!’
“We’re always reacting. That is the sport. We dwell a recreation that’s passionate, you recognize, and we play to win and it has to occur and it’s a must to react.
“If not, let’s sit right here within the theatre, be on mute, and let’s see if this league and this recreation is as attention-grabbing.
“It gained’t. That’s what makes it so particular.”
Requested if it’s unattainable to count on individuals to vary their behaviour, Arteta stated: “No, it’s (attainable), however we’ve got to ask, what does that imply? What does it imply to ‘enhance it’?”
Responding to the reporter’s suggestion about exhibiting extra respect, the Arsenal boss replied: “How? It’s like an onion and we speak superficially so we’ve got to go to the underside of it.
“What can we count on from one another? ‘This, that is good behavour’.
“In the event that they inform me ‘these three issues are going to assist’ then consider me, I’ll attempt my finest to assist, for positive, however we’ve got to be detailed.
“Don’t speak globally about one scenario three months later as a result of we’ve got to go to the historical past of why all of us say how we behave as a result of I will be actually good right here at this time due to three years in the past.”
